The Highway Guardrail Roll Forming Machine is expertly engineered for crafting guardrails used along roadways. This advanced system seamlessly handles the entire production process—uncoiling, feeding, punching, roll forming, logo embossing, and precise cutting to length. Equipped with a sophisticated PLC control system and an AV inverter for smooth speed regulation, the machine operates with full automation, ensuring efficiency and precision. It is an indispensable tool for the steel structure and road transportation industries, capable of producing both two-wave and three-wave guardrail profiles using a dual-cassette design.Tailored to meet specific customer requirements, the machine offers customizable configurations to suit unique technical needs.Our Crash Barrier Forming Equipment is designed to manufacture W-beam guardrails, available in two-wave and three-wave profiles, ideal for installation on highways or expressways. Powered by a robust gearbox drive—offering greater stability than traditional chain-driven systems—the equipment includes a manual decoiler, material feeding unit, raw material leveling system, punching mechanism, main forming unit, and automatic cutting system. The final guardrail is cut to the desired length using an encoder for precise measurement, with the machine automatically pausing to execute cuts and resuming operation seamlessly. Additional beams may be required to secure the guardrail, and punching holes are incorporated as needed, typically for guardrails with a standard thickness of 3-4mm.With extensive experience in guardrail roll forming technology, our machines are built to comply with various international standards, including:
- AASHTO M180 (American Standard)
- RAL RG620 (German Standard)
- BS EN-1317 (European Standard)
- AS/NZS 3845:1999 (Australian Standard)
Work flow
Decoiling → Leveling→ Flat cutting → Punching→ Roll forming →Logo punching →Cutting→ Run out table (automatic stacker)
